PROCAP is proud to have finalized two acquisitions beginning of 2009
Tuesday 27. January 2009 - The first company is Mc Farlane Plastics based in Newtownmountkennedy and previously owned by the Mc Farlane Group.
This company produces mainly snap caps and spoons for the baby food industry and other plastic caps & closures for the food and chemical industry.
The company has realised in 2008 a turn over of 9 millions with 38 employees.
This company fits perfectly in the strategic development of Procap in the segment of snap caps and in his regional European expansion.
The second company is Elocap Lux based in Rodange in the Grand-Duchy of Luxemburg. This company was owned at by Elocap Ltd based in Israel who is owned 50/50 by Elopak AS (Norway) and Kibbutz Yakum (Israel). This acquisition includes also an important Manufacture & Supply contract to Elopak AS. Elocap Lux has started the production in Rodange end 2006 and has realised a turn over of 5 million in 2008 with 18 employees. With this acquisition Procap enters in a market segment where we are not very important and with an important growth rate: the market of caps for carton packaging. This acquisition reinforces also the geographical position of Procap in the hart of Europe.
These two acquisition shows that Procap is participating to the necessary restructuration of the European market of plastic caps & closures. These acquisitions are also a clear signal to the market that Procap has the means and the will to continue to grow in Europe.
